SIROHI: A massive tree plantation drive was organized at the Barlut government school campus in Sirohi district on Saturday under the “Ek Ped Maa Ke Naam” campaign. Initiated following the call of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Rajasthan Chief Minister Bhajanlal Sharma, the event aimed to actively promote environmental conservation.

Minister of State for Panchayati Raj and Rural Development, Otaram Dewasi, and Jalore-Sirohi Member of Parliament (MP), Lumbaram Choudhary, led the initiative by planting saplings. Addressing the gathering, Dewasi emphasized that protecting nature remains the fundamental responsibility of every citizen.

He noted that the Ek Ped Maa Ke Naam campaign extends beyond merely planting saplings; it represents a serious pledge to secure a clean and safe environment for future generations. Dewasi urged everyone to plant at least one tree in their lifetime and ensure its regular upkeep to make the initiative a success.

A Call for Public Participation

MP Choudhary echoed these sentiments, describing environmental conservation as the most pressing need of the current era. He praised the nationwide campaign as an outstanding example of public participation and ecological responsibility.

Choudhary appealed directly to the youth, students, and the general public to plant maximum trees and protect them. Following the official addresses, attendees planted various species of saplings across the school premises and collectively resolved to nurture them.

Addressing Public Grievances

Later in the day, Minister Dewasi held a public hearing at the local Circuit House to address citizen grievances. He received multiple administrative and departmental complaints from local residents during the session.

Taking immediate action, Dewasi directed the concerned departmental officials to resolve the issues promptly and provide immediate relief to the complainants. The day’s events underscored the administration’s dual focus on ecological sustainability and proactive grassroots governance.
